Watch the Blue Origin sensor test that will help NASA land on the Moon (update: scrubbed)
September 24, 2020
Update 12:12PM ET: According to NASA, Blue Origin detected “a potential issue with the power supply to the experiments,” so today’s launch has been scrubbed. No word yet on a new target date.
Blue Origin is set to launch its reusable New Shepard rocket on a suborbital mission today (September 24th) and test sensors for a vehicle that could one day land on the Moon. The NS-13 mission, using…
